DUDLEY Town chairman Steve Austin says the team are capable of much more following a frustrating start to their West Midlands Premier campaign.
The Robins lost 1-0 away at Bewdley Town last Saturday to take their early season tally to four points from three games.
Austin said: “It has been disappointing because we should have beaten Bewdley.
“It is disappointing because we expect more. It is the standard that we set for ourselves.
“The players are training twice this week because they are determined to set the record straight.”
Town take on Pegasus Juniors at The Dell this Saturday.
